NETCOMMUNITYDEFAULTCODEMAP (4.0SP17)

The NETCOMMUNITYDEFAULTCODEMAP table maps various default code table entries for Blackbaud Internet Solutions transactions.

Primary Key
Primary Key Field Type

ID

uniqueidentifier

Foreign Key Fields
Foreign Key Field Type Null Notes Description

BUSINESSPHONECODEID

uniqueidentifier

false

FK to PHONETYPECODE

FAXPHONECODEID

uniqueidentifier

true

FK to PHONETYPECODE

RELATIONSHIPTYPECODEID

uniqueidentifier

false

FK to RELATIONSHIPTYPECODE

PRIMARYBUSINESSRELATIONSHIPTYPECODEID

uniqueidentifier

false

FK to RELATIONSHIPTYPECODE

PRIMARYBUSINESSRECIPROCALTYPECODEID

uniqueidentifier

false

FK to RELATIONSHIPTYPECODE

BUSINESSADDRESSTYPECODEID

uniqueidentifier

false

FK to ADDRESSTYPECODE

MGCONDITIONTYPECODEID

uniqueidentifier

true

FK to MATCHINGGIFTCONDITIONTYPECODE

REVENUENOTETYPECODEID

uniqueidentifier

true

FK to REVENUENOTETYPECODE

CONSTITUENTLINKPAGEID

uniqueidentifier

true

FK to PAGEDEFINITIONCATALOG

ADDEDBYID

uniqueidentifier

false

FK to CHANGEAGENT.

CHANGEDBYID

uniqueidentifier

false

FK to CHANGEAGENT.

CONTACTTYPECODEID

uniqueidentifier

false

FK to CONTACTTYPECODE

SPOUSEREMOVEDRELATIONSHIPTYPECODEID

uniqueidentifier

false

FK to RELATIONSHIPTYPECODE

PRIMARYADDRESSTYPECODEID

uniqueidentifier

true

FK to ADDRESSTYPECODE

ORGANIZATIONPRIMARYADDRESSTYPECODEID

uniqueidentifier

true

FK to ADDRESSTYPECODE

CHANNELCODEID

uniqueidentifier

true

FK to CHANNELCODE

MGALIASTYPECODEID

uniqueidentifier

true

FK to ALIASTYPECODE

DONOTEMAILSOLICITCODEID

uniqueidentifier

false

FK to SOLICITCODE

INFOSOURCECODEID

uniqueidentifier

true

FK to INFOSOURCECODE

FORMERADDRESSTYPECODEID

uniqueidentifier

true

FK to ADDRESSTYPECODE

EMAILADDRESSTYPECODEID

uniqueidentifier

true

DONOTEMAILCONSENTSOLICITCODEID

uniqueidentifier

true

DATAPROTECTIONEVIDENCESOURCECODEID

uniqueidentifier

true

Fields
Field Field Type Null Notes Description

DATEADDED

datetime

false

getdate()

Indicates the date this record was added.

DATECHANGED

datetime

false

getdate()

Indicates the date this record was last changed.

TS

timestamp

false

Timestamp.

TSLONG

bigint (Computed)

true

Numeric representation of the timestamp.

AUTOMATCHUSELASTNAME

bit

false

0

AUTOMATCHUSEFIRSTNAME

bit

false

0

AUTOMATCHUSEMAIDENNAME

bit

false

0

AUTOMATCHUSEBIRTHDATE

bit

false

0

AUTOMATCHUSEGENDER

bit

false

0

AUTOMATCHEXACTMATCHONLY

bit

false

1

AUTOMATCHINCLUDEINACTIVE

bit

false

0

AUTOMATCHINCLUDEDECEASED

bit

false

1

AUTOMATCHUSEMIDDLENAME

bit

false

0

AUTOMATCHUSEADDRESS

bit

false

0

AUTOMATCHUSECITY

bit

false

0

AUTOMATCHUSECOUNTRY

bit

false

0

AUTOMATCHUSECOUNTY

bit

false

0

AUTOMATCHUSENZCITY

bit

false

0

AUTOMATCHUSENZSUBURB

bit

false

0

AUTOMATCHUSESTATE

bit

false

0

AUTOMATCHUSEZIP

bit

false

0

AUTOMATCHUSEPHONE

bit

false

0

AUTOMATCHUSELOOKUPID

bit

false

1

PLUGINSERVICEURL

UDT_WEBADDRESS

false

''

AUTOMATCHUSEEMAIL

bit

false

0

AUTOMATCHUSESUFFIX

bit

false

0

Indexes
Index Name Field(s) Unique Primary Clustered

IX_NETCOMMUNITYDEFAULTCODEMAP_DATEADDED

DATEADDED

False

False

True

IX_NETCOMMUNITYDEFAULTCODEMAP_DATECHANGED

DATECHANGED

False

False

False

PK_NETCOMMUNITYDEFAULTCODEMAP

ID

True

True

False

Triggers
Trigger Name Description

TR_NETCOMMUNITYDEFAULTCODEMAP_AUDIT_UPDATE

TR_NETCOMMUNITYDEFAULTCODEMAP_AUDIT_DELETE